B.Sc. Forensic Science is an undergraduate program that focuses on the scientific and technical aspects of forensic investigation, crime scene analysis, and evidence analysis. The course curriculum is designed to provide students with a comprehensive understanding of the application of scientific methods and techniques to legal matters. The course duration is generally three years, although this can vary depending on the institution and the specific program. The curriculum of the BSc in Forensic Science program includes subjects such as forensic biology, forensic chemistry, forensic psychology, forensic medicine, forensic ballistics, criminal law, and forensic anthropology. The course also includes laboratory work, case studies, and practical training in areas such as crime scene investigation, fingerprint analysis, DNA analysis, and toxicology.
The eligibility criteria for admission to BSc Forensic Science courses in India vary from institution to institution. Typically, candidates are required to have completed 10+2 or equivalent with the science stream. Graduates of the BSc Forensic Science program can pursue careers in forensic labs, law enforcement agencies, private investigation firms, research organizations, and government agencies.
Upon completing the studies at the BSc Forensic Science colleges in UP, students can also opt for higher education in the field of forensic science or related fields. Students who complete the BSc Forensic Science program acquire skills in critical thinking, problem-solving, laboratory techniques, analytical reasoning, and communication. They also develop an understanding of the legal system and its procedures.
